Telangana PCC president N. Uttam Kumar Reddy on Tuesday said that the Congress is org-anisationally very strong in the state, with four lakh Congress soldiers.

Speaking at a meeting as part of the Leadership Development Mission in Reserved Constituencies (LDMRC), Mr Reddy said that the work of LDMRC has been going really well in improving the party in the reserved constituencies. He said this model should be extended to all Assembly constituencies in the state.

Mr Reddy said that a leader should work with voters. He said that in the coming elections, technical resources will have more effect and the party should collect in-depth information.He said that LDMRC had collected information from 31 Assembly constituencies and this should be extended to all general constituencies. “If polling booth-level leaders meet the people and collect information, according to the forms prepared by the Congress technical division, and extend the required help and assistance, then the Congress will go further nearer to the people,” he said.

AICC leader Koppula Raju said that remaining constituencies have also taken it up and will collect information.
